Chemotaxis Assay for CXCR3-Mediated Migration

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Chemotaxis assay was performed using 24-well Transwell plates (Costar, 3415, USA). One milliliter supernatants from ME180 cells which were mock-infected or infected with HSV-2, or mock-transfected or transfected with ICP4 expressing plasmid were added to the lower chamber. To examine the roles of CXCR3 and CXCR3 ligands in mediating cell migration, supernatants or cells were incubated with anti-CXCL9 (10 μg/mL, R&D Systems, MAB392, USA), -CXCL10 (2 μg/mL, R&D Systems, MAB266, USA), -CXCL11 (2 μg/mL, R&D Systems, MAB672, USA) or -CXCR3 (1 μg/mL, R&D Systems, MAB160, USA) neutralizing Abs, respectively, for 1 h, according to the manufacturer's instructions. Activated PBMCs and CD4+ T cells (5 × 105) in 100 μL RPMI-1640 medium were added to the upper chamber. The chambers were incubated for 2 h at 37°C in a 5% CO2 incubator. Cell migrated to the lower chambers were collected and counted using an automatic cell counter (Bio-Rad).

CXCL11 Modulates Cell Migration

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
MHCC-97H and Huh-7 cells were cultured with NF-CM, CAF-CM or CAF-CM containing different concentrations of CXCL11 recombinant protein (10876-HNAE, SinoBiological, China) or CXCL11 neutralizing antibody (MAB672, R&D Systems, USA) for 72 h. Then, Transwell, wound healing, IF, and western blot assays were performed.
